The standard oxidation ptoetial of zinic is 0.76 V and of silver is -0.80 V calculate the emf of the cell
`Zn|Zn(NO_(3))_(2)(0.25 M)||AgNO_(3)(0.1)M|Ag "at" 25^(@) C`

A

1.158 V

B

1.352 V

C

0.768 V

D

21.32 V

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The cell reaction is `Zn+ 2Ag^(+) rarr 2 Ag + Zn^(2+)`
`E_("cell")^(@)=E_("oxi")^(@)` of `Zn + e_("red")^(@)` of `Ag=0.76 +0.80 =1.56 V`
We know that
`E_("cell") =E_("cell")^(@)-(0.0591)/(n) log [("products")]/[("reactants")] =E_("cell")^(@) -(0.0591)/(2) log (0.25)/(0.1xx0.1)`
`=1.56 -(0.0591)/(2) xx (1.0591)/(2)xx1.3979 =1.3979 =(1.56 -0 0.0413) V, E_("cell")=1.5187 V`
